From Phantom of The Opera at the Royal Albert Hall (2011): In celebration of the 25th Anniversary of Andrew Lloyd Webber's The Phantom of the Opera, Cameron Mackintosh produced a unique, spectacular staging of the musical on a scale which had never been seen before. Inspired by the original staging by Hal Prince and Gillian Lynne, this lavish, fully-staged production set in the sumptuous Victorian splendour of London's legendary Royal Albert Hall features a cast and orchestra of over 200, plus some very special guest appearances.

I often feel she gets a bad rap as just being an annoying Diva, when in Webbers Version I’ve always seen her as a Woman who has most likely fought tooth and nail for years to achieve the success she has in the Opera World (she didn’t have a Phantom helping her) and she knows her days as the Prima Donna are numbered as she’s getting older and so she tries to compensate by showboating and just plain overdoing it. Not to mention for three years she had to put up with the Opera Ghost targeting her with his attacks and threatening her.
Her feeling jealous of Christine is understandable, because while Christine has the talent, she wouldn’t have risen to the top to replace Carlotta without The Phantom manipulating events to put her there, because even with the voice of an angel Christine doesn’t have the cut throat personality, she’s too sweet to claw her way to the top of the Opera World without Erik doing the dirt work, and she would never have gotten out of the Ballet Corps without him.
So in Carlottas eyes she’s being thrown over by a little upstart who hasn’t even paid her dues in the trenches yet, and so in her mind doesn’t deserve it. Sure it doesn’t justify Carlotta being a b*tch to Christine but I think one can understand where her anger is coming from LOL.
